Package: x11-common
Version: 1:7.6+2
Severity: important

Hello,

I'm currently running systemd instead of sysv. When I tried to update to the last version of x11-common, the configuration of he package failed :
Setting up x11-common (1:7.6+2) ...
Reloading systemd
Starting x11-common (via systemctl): x11-common.serviceFailed to issue method call: Unit x11-common.service is masked.
failed!
invoke-rc.d: initscript x11-common, action "start" failed.
dpkg: error processing x11-common (--configure):
subprocess installed post-installation script returned error exit status 1
configured to not write apport reports
Errors were encountered while processing:
x11-common
E: Sub-process /usr/bin/dpkg returned an error code (1)
